Stripe has been quietly rebuilding its embedded component library, and v2 is a substantial upgrade. The new components cover the full lifecycle of a platform seller: onboarding (including identity verification and bank account linking), an earnings dashboard, payout scheduling, and tax document management. Each component is a drop-in React element that handles the complex compliance requirements behind the scenes.

What makes this release significant is the level of customization. Previous Stripe embedded experiences felt like iframes from another planet - they looked nothing like your app and offered minimal styling options. V2 components accept full CSS theming, match your design system, and render as native DOM elements rather than iframes. The onboarding flow alone replaces what would typically take 2-3 weeks of custom development to build properly.

For founders building marketplace or SaaS platforms with payouts, this cuts months off the roadmap. The components handle edge cases that most teams discover painfully late: international tax requirements, identity re-verification, payout failure handling, and 1099 generation. Stripe is clearly betting that developers will build more platforms if the infrastructure pain is removed, and this release goes a long way toward that.
